2025年中国智能客服系统技术盘点:十大高性能开源方案深度解析(附Golang实战指南)

2025-10-06

2025年中国智能客服系统技术盘点:十大高性能开源方案深度解析(附Golang实战指南)

演示网站:gofly.v1kf.com
我的微信:llike620
我的微信

各位老铁们好啊,今天咱们不聊CRUD,来点硬核的——聊聊2025年最值得后端工程师关注的智能客服系统。说实话,现在市面上的客服系统要么是SaaS版黑盒子,要么是性能拉胯的玩具级开源项目,直到我发现了这个能让你直呼『真香』的解决方案…

一、为什么说2025年是智能客服的技术分水岭?

最近帮朋友公司做技术选型,把国内主流方案扒了个底朝天。发现三个关键趋势: 1. 大模型集成已成标配:但90%的方案还在用HTTP轮询这种上古交互方式 2. 云原生部署崛起:K8s+容器化方案开始吊打传统虚拟机部署 3. 性能差距悬殊:同样的硬件配置,有的系统并发撑不过500,有的却能轻松破万

二、十大开源方案技术解剖(含私货评测)

2.1 唯一客服系统(本期主角)

go // 看看这个优雅的并发处理设计 func (s *Server) handleStream(ctx context.Context, conn *websocket.Conn) { for { select { case <-ctx.Done(): return default: msg := s.pool.Get().(*Message) if err := conn.ReadJSON(msg); err == nil { go s.processMessage(msg) // 协程池优化过的消息处理 } } } }

技术亮点: - 纯Golang开发,单实例轻松扛住8000+WS长连接 - 独创的『插件式AI网关』设计(对接扣子API只要5行配置) - 内存占用比Java方案低60%,我这台4核8G的测试机跑出了1.2万QPS

2.2 FastGPT系方案

虽然文档丰富,但实际部署时发现: - Node.js事件循环在复杂会话场景容易阻塞 - 需要额外开发消息队列才能实现可靠重试

2.3 Dify等Python系方案

Docker镜像动不动就3GB+,启动时间堪比SpringBoot(懂的都懂)

…(其他7个方案对比略)…

三、为什么说『唯一客服』是工程化最优解?

上周用这个系统给电商客户做了次压力测试,结果直接惊到CTO: 1. 冷启动时间:从docker pull到服务就绪仅需28秒(对比某Python方案需要4分钟) 2. 内存管理:持续运行72小时后内存增长曲线几乎水平 3. 扩展性:通过简单的gRPC接口就能接入自研的推荐系统

最骚的是他们的智能体源码完全开放,比如这个对话状态机实现: go type StateMachine struct { current State // 零拷贝设计的状态上下文 ctx *context.Context transitions map[State]map[Event]Handler }

func (sm *StateMachine) Handle(event Event) { if handler, exists := sm.transitions[sm.current][event]; exists { handler(sm.ctx) // 无锁状态转换 } }

四、你可能关心的五个工程问题

Q1:如何对接私有化大模型?

他们在config.yaml里预留了LLM_Adapter接口,我们团队对接自研模型只花了半天

Q2:K8s部署有坑吗?

实测1.4.0版本已经支持Helm Chart,不过建议改下这个HPA配置: yaml metrics: - type: External external: metric: name: ws_connections_per_pod selector: {matchLabels: {app: customer-service}} target: type: AverageValue averageValue: 5000

Q3:消息顺序如何保证?

系统内置了带优先级的Channel实现,关键代码在pkg/queue/priority_channel.go

五、说点掏心窝子的

作为写过多个客服系统的老司机,第一次看到用sync.Pool做消息对象复用的设计时确实眼前一亮。虽然文档还有些拼写错误(作者说下个版本改进),但代码质量绝对是企业级水准。

最近他们刚更新了v1.5-beta,支持了分布式会话追踪。准备下周拿这个功能替换公司现有的ELK方案,到时候再给大家分享实战心得。

最后放个彩蛋:在唯一客服的GitHub仓库issues里提『来自技术博客推荐』,作者说会优先处理技术问题(亲测有效)